CDZI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2021 in Review

68 of the 5,695 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Cadiz (CDZI) for Q1 2021, worth a combined $62.8M — down 46% from $116M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 6 funds opened new CDZI positions and 4 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 17 added to existing stakes and 27 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Renaissance Technologies, opening a new position worth an estimated $796K. The largest seller was KBC Group, cutting an estimated $7.23M.
